About Pound-moles per day
The pound-mole per day (lb-mol/d) equals 453.59237/86400 ≈ 5.249×10⁻³ mol/s, used for daily material-balance reconciliation in US petroleum refineries and chemical plants. Process computer logs accumulate flow integrals as lb-mol/d; pipeline natural-gas custody-transfer accounting also uses lb-mol/d figures in US contracts. 1 lb-mol/d ≈ 5.249×10⁻³ mol/s = 453.59 mol/d.
About Nanomoles per hour
The nanomole per hour (nmol/h) equals 10⁻⁹/3600 ≈ 2.778×10⁻¹³ mol/s, used in membrane transport kinetics, stable-isotope tracer pharmacokinetics, and slow enzymatic reactions in isolated cells. Urea cycle flux in isolated hepatocytes and copper transport across intestinal epithelia are typically measured in nmol/h per mg protein. 1 nmol/h ≈ 2.778×10⁻¹³ mol/s.
